North Carolina Police Officer Shoots, Kills Man
ASSOCIATED PRESS
RALEIGH, N.C. (AP) -- An off-duty police officer shot and killed a man who was stealing her personal vehicle outside a restaurant early Sunday, police said.
Officer Michelle Peele's vehicle was parked in front of La Rosa Linda's restaurant, where she was working as a security guard. Peele confronted the suspect, then fired one shot, striking Nyles Arrington, 42.
Police said Arrington then drove the vehicle across the street, struck a parked vehicle, drove back across the street and stopped in the median.
Emergency workers transported him to a hospital where he was pronounced dead, police said.
No further details were immediately available.
Peele, who has been with the Raleigh Police Department since June 1999, was placed on administrative duties.
The police department and the State Bureau of Investigation are investigating, a standard procedure in shootings involving police.
